Video: Baby Dayliner - "Breezy" (live)

Nov 20, 07

Ethan Marunas aka Baby Dayliner is an interesting character.  Ably mixing 80s David Bowie, Mellow Gold-era Beck (which BTW we think is the best Beck there is), the best pop standards from the 50s and 60s, David Byrne solo, some Morrissey AND cabaret, the NYC-native and one-man band has been going at his act strong for many years, all the while remaining something of a hyper-literate, hyper-addictive, brashly original artist.  This video, for "Breezy", was recorded live at The Note in Chicago.
